About the Bambu Lab X2D

The dual-nozzle successor to the X1 Carbon. Adds a second extruder for low-waste multi-color, a 65C active heated chamber, and HEPA filtration at a far lower launch price.

With a build volume of 256 x 256 x 256mm, the Bambu Lab X2D offers a generous print area suitable for large projects and functional parts.

The maximum hotend temperature of 300°C allows printing with high-temperature materials like Nylon and Polycarbonate.

This printer is rated as Beginner level, making it an excellent choice for those new to 3D printing.
